Program Engineer

3 months ago


Indianapolis, Indiana, United States REXEL Full time
The position of Program Engineer will be based out of our Indianapolis, IN location

Summary

The Program Engineer will be responsible for Identifying, developing, and implementing customer solutions that are accretive to the existing business. This role will support the Parts Super Center (PSC) initiatives for on-time & defect free product fulfilment. The Program Engineer will also create detailed program sales strategies & initiatives for channel partners and end customers.

What You'll Do

  • Oversee modifications and complex quotations and orders
  • Work with sourcing to identify and transition commodities to new suppliers where applicable
  • Manage a team of Technical Specialists who are responsible for producing quotations, processing orders and associated bills of materials & drawings
  • Develop and implement lean style process improvements for quotations and order fulfilment
  • Identify & lead "cost out" supply chain opportunities to maintain competitive pricing
  • Lead all program efforts to achieve on time delivery QMS targets
  • Act as the primary interface with sourcing, quality, operations, and inside sales for non-conforming material to maintain QMS compliance
  • Actively pursue key accounts in conjunction with Regional Sales Leaders and Inside Sales Team to achieve commercial goals
  • Responsible for technical proposals
  • Responsible for training
  • Identify complimentary sales adjacencies for the program and across programs
  • Other duties as assigned

What You'll Need

  • Post-Secondary Mechanical or Electrical Engineering
  • CAD/CAM
  • 10+ years direct experience
  • Leadership experience preferred
  • Mechanical or Electrical Design of Medium & High Voltage Circuit Breakers & Switchgear
  • Experience with Field Service & Project Quotations
  • Manufacturing & Contract Manufacturing
  • Application & Requisition Engineering

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

  • Working knowledge of IEEE Switchgear & Circuit Breaker Standards
  • Ability to read Electrical One Line, Schematic & Wiring Diagrams
  • Familiar with US installed switchgear base and industry segments
  • Knowledge of customer maintenance and operating practices including repair/replace decision making
  • Understanding of life extension processes for switch gear
  • Ability to develop tailored technical and commercial solutions per customer requirements
